Partager via


STArea (type de données geography)

Retourne la surface d'exposition totale d'une instance geography. Les résultats de STArea() sont retournés dans le carré de l'unité de mesure utilisée par l'identificateur de référence spatial de l'instance geography ; par exemple, si le SRID de l'instance est 4326, STArea() retourne les résultats en mètres carrés.

Syntaxe

.STArea ( )

Types des valeurs de retour

SQL Server : float

Type de retour CLR : SqlDouble

Notes

STArea() retourne 0 si une instance geography contient uniquement des figures à 0 et 1 dimension, ou si elle est vide.

[!REMARQUE]

Les méthodes sur le type de données geography qui produisent une valeur de retour métrique auront des résultats différents selon le SRID de l'instance utilisé dans la méthode. Pour plus d'informations sur les SRID, consultez Identificateurs de référence spatiale (SRID).

Exemples

L'exemple suivant utilise STArea() pour créer une instance Polygongeography et calcule la surface du polygone.

DECLARE @g geography;
SET @g = geography::STGeomFromText('POLYGON((-122.358 47.653, -122.348 47.649, -122.348 47.658, -122.358 47.658, -122.358 47.653))', 4326);
SELECT @g.STArea();

Voir aussi

Autres ressources

Méthodes OGC sur les instances geography